European Approach

The European Approach for Quality Assurance of Joint Programmes (European Approach, EA) is applied to evaluation or accreditation procedures for joint programmes with the aim that the evaluation or accreditation decision can be recognised in all partner countries participating in the programme. Since different conditions and requirements may apply depending on national regulations, the universities should therefore inquire about the recognition options in the respective countries prior to the evaluation procedure, provide evidence of this information and name specific contact persons in the respective country (national authorities such as ministry, agency, accreditation council etc.).

The European Approach is generally designed for all joint programmes (including double degrees and other cooperative constellations). The cooperation partners should decide jointly whether the evaluation of their study programme should follow the European Approach. ACQUIN can only provide advice in this regard, considering that the EA entails a certain additional effort, which must be taken into account in the cost calculation and in the schedule for the procedure.

The programme is assessed using the standards for quality assurance of joint programmes in the European Higher Education Area (EHEA) in accordance with the requirements and assessment criteria of the European Approach for Quality Assurance of Joint Programmes based on the document “Quality Assurance of Joint Programmes in the EHEA: European Approach” as well as the “European Standards and Guidelines for Quality Assurance in the European Higher Education Area (ESG)“.

When applying the European Approach, the assessment must be carried out by an agency listed in the European Quality Assurance Register for Higher Education (EQAR), which includes ACQUIN.
